Transaction d38ea4648b908bde4c07d1560e8673eca198091c595d812b31a673032dae5cf5

6 Input
2 Outputs
  • d38ea4648b908bde4c07d1560e8673eca198091c595d812b31a673032dae5cf5:0
  • value  34740199
    address  3HrR4BzLRpbDzABeZ6iiQ9ih9HySebFK42
  • d38ea4648b908bde4c07d1560e8673eca198091c595d812b31a673032dae5cf5:1
  • value  540740781
    address  3GmFUFVGhm17nNqmAQiY1LsxdijD1CGo95